1. What is Cone Volume?

Cone volume represents the amount of three-dimensional space occupied by a cone. It's calculated using the mathematical formula that relates the cone's radius and height to its volume capacity.

2. How Does the Calculator Work?

The calculator uses the cone volume formula:

\[ V = \frac{1}{3} \pi r^2 h \]

Where:

Explanation: The formula calculates the volume by finding the area of the circular base (πr²) and multiplying it by one-third of the height, accounting for the cone's tapering shape.

5. Frequently Asked Questions (FAQ)

Q1: Why is there a 1/3 factor in the formula?
A: The 1/3 factor accounts for the fact that a cone's volume is exactly one-third the volume of a cylinder with the same base and height.

Q2: What units should I use for measurements?
A: Use consistent units (cm, m, inches, etc.) for both radius and height. The volume will be in cubic units of your measurement.

Q3: Can I calculate volume with diameter instead of radius?
A: Yes, simply divide the diameter by 2 to get the radius, then use the formula with the radius value.
